Easy Homemade Slushies

A sweet, simple and inexpensive frozen drink for summer.

Ingredients

  • 4 cups of cold water
  • 1 cup of sugar sugar substitutes do NOT work well in this recipe, it freezes best with sugar
  • 1 1/2 tsp flavor extract such as raspberry lemon, orange, cotton candy, cherry or vanilla
  • 2-6 drops food coloring as desired - since this is just for appearances you can completely omit if you prefer

Instructions

  • In a large bowl, combine water and sugar and stir until sugar is completely dissolved. Add in flavor extract and stir well. Follow with a few drops of food coloring to achieve your desired color. Stir well. Pour into your ice cream maker (this recipe was tested in a 1 and 1/2 quart ice cream maker) and turn on and run according to ice cream maker package directions. Let run for approximately 20-30 minutes or until desired consistency is reached. Serve immediately.
